Definitions Specific to this Policy

The CCPA includes definitions for terms specific to this California Privacy Policy that do not apply to Regis’ privacy policy, including the following terms:

Personal Information” means information that identifies, relates to, describes, is reasonably capable of being associated with, or could reasonably be linked, directly or indirectly, with a particular consumer or household.  Personal Information does not include publicly available information obtained from government records; deidentified or aggregated consumer information that cannot be reconstructed to identify you; any information covered under the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act or the California Financial Information Privacy Act, activities covered by the Fair Credit Reporting Act, or protected health information as defined under the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act. 

Sale” or “sell” means selling, renting, releasing, disclosing, disseminating, making available, transferring, or otherwise communicating orally, in writing, or by electronic or other means, a consumer’s personal information by the business to another business or a third party for monetary or other valuable consideration.

Service Provider” means a sole proprietorship, partnership, limited liability company, corporation, association, or other legal entity that is organized or operated for the profit or financial benefit of its shareholders or other owners, that processes information on behalf of a business and to which the business discloses a consumer’s Personal Information for a business purpose pursuant to a written contract.

Third Party” means a person or entity who is not a business that collects Personal Information from consumers, as defined in the CCPA, and to whom the business discloses a consumer’s Personal Information for a business purpose pursuant to a written contract.

Authorized Agents

You may designate an authorized agent to exercise your rights under the CCPA on your behalf.  

Pursuant to the CCPA:

  • Only a business entity or natural person registered with the California Secretary of State may act as an authorized agent.

  • You must provide the authorized agent written permission to exercise your rights under the CCPA on your behalf.

  • We may deny a request from an authorized agent on your behalf if the authorized agent does not submit proof that he, she, or it has been authorized by you to act on your behalf if we request such proof, as permitted by the CCPA.

  • Even if you use an authorized agent to exercise your rights under the CCPA on your behalf, pursuant to the CCPA we may still require that you verify your own identity directly to us. This provision does not apply if you have provided with a power of attorney under California Probate Code sections 4000 to 4465.

Personal Information of Minors – Opting In

We do not sell the Personal Information of minors who are at least 13 years old and less than 16 years old unless those individuals have opted in to the sale of their Personal Information.  To opt in, such a minor must first clearly request to opt in via the link below, after which the minor will be required to separately confirm that election.  As part of that confirmation process, the minor will be informed that he or she has the right to opt out at a later date and what the process is for doing so.

If you are 13, 14, or 15 years old and would like to opt in to the sale of your Personal Information, contact privacyrequest@regiscorp.com.  

We do not sell the Personal Information of minors who are under 13 years old unless a parent or guardian of that minor affirmatively authorizes the sale of that Personal Information.  We verify that the individual making such an authorization is the minor’s parent or guardian by a) having a parent or guardian call our toll-free number staffed by trained personnel, b) having a parent or guardian communicate in person with trained personnel, or c) providing a consent form to be signed by the parent or guardian under penalty of perjury and returned to the business by postal mail or electronic scan. As part of that verification process, the parent or guardian will be informed that he or she may opt out on behalf of the minor at a later date and what the process is for doing so.
